Do the horses really need to be put down
It depends on the injury pete, very often if a horse breaks a leg because of their weight it breaks in more than one place and very often breaks through the skin and splinters, this itself can cause infection and further suffering unlike dogs they dont do well trying to distribute around 1000lbs of body weight on 3 legs.
You cant easily put a horse in plaster and keep them from moving they have to be put in slings to keep the weight off and the facilities for physio in water is usually required for a semi full recovery after, a facility alot of people dont have.
The hardest thing to achieve is to keep the animal still and rested enough to allow the bones to set and that is if you have managed to move the animal to a place they can be put in a sling without doing further damage to the original break or fracture which is what very often happens.
Also long term they tend to spend the rest of their lives suffering from such injury due to poor bone infusion which isn’t fair on the animal.poli you always make a lot of sense to me.
